Hydroponics is fundamentally a method of cultivating plants. It is based on a nutrient-rich solution in water rather than soil. The idea may appear to be unfamiliar but it has been around long enough.<\/p>\n\n\n\n
Hydroponics is a sophisticated process with a variety of strategies for ensuring that the nutrient solution reaches the plants. They include the following:<\/p>\n\n\n\n
This is the simplest and most cost-effective method of running hydroponics. The wick connects the plant to the reservoir containing a nutrient solution, steadily feeding it over time. Absorbent materials, such as cotton, are the most popular medium for slowly moving water and nutrients to the plant.<\/p>\n\n\n\n
Deepwater culture, occasionally referred to as the reservoir method, happens to be the simplest method of operating hydroponics as well. The roots are suspended directly in the nutritional solution, and growers must use an aquarium air pump to keep the solution oxygenated so that the plants do not drown.<\/p>\n\n\n\n
Aeroponics involves dangling the roots in the air and spraying them with a solution. This method of promoting growth involves striking the roots with a pond fogger or a fine spray nozzle.<\/p>\n\n\n\n
This method is based on the absorption of oxygen from the air by a continuous flow of nutritional solution over the plant’s roots. To successfully implement this approach, the plants must be grown at a small angle to allow the solution to flow downward. This may seem like a pain, but the higher growth rate makes it worthwhile!<\/p>\n\n\n\n
